Why Folsom Homes Need Roofing Upgrades Now
Guard your property against high wind gusts, heavy seasonal rain, and intense heat.
Homeowners in Folsom, California routinely face challenging weather hazards, including intense summer solar radiation, severe winter storm wind gusts, and heavy seasonal rainfall across the Sacramento Valley. Aging asphalt shingle roofs are particularly vulnerable to thermal blistering, granule loss, and moisture infiltration after enduring years of extreme temperature fluctuations. To protect against costly interior water damage, professional roofing contractors recommend upgrading to cool-roof architectural shingles or standing seam metal roofing. These advanced roofing systems feature reflective granules and reinforced fiberglass mats engineered to shed heavy rain loads and withstand high wind velocity common across Sacramento County.
Is It Time for a New Roof in Folsom?
Spot warning signs of roof degradation before interior leaks happen.
Excessive shingle granule loss collecting in gutters or washing out of downspouts
Missing, cracked, curling, or wind-lifted asphalt shingles across roof planes
Water stains on interior ceilings or dampness in attic insulation layers
Sagging roof deck lines indicating underlying structural moisture rot
Damaged flashing or cracked rubber boots around chimney and vent pipes

Folsom Roofing Cost Guide
Estimated local pricing tiers for roof repair and replacement.
- Basic Tier: Ranges from $6,500 to $9,500 for standard asphalt 3-tab shingle installation on an average-sized single-family home.
- Mid-Range Tier: Ranges from $10,500 to $17,000, covering architectural dimensional shingles with upgraded synthetic underlayment.
- Premium Tier: Costs $18,000 to $32,000+ for premium metal roofing systems or luxury impact-rated architectural shingles designed for extreme durability.
- Note: The cost to replace a roof varies depending on your home's size, roof pitch, and material chosen.
Folsom Roofing Installation Facts & Figures
Industry standards and performance metrics for local roofs.
- Energy Savings: Reflective cool-roof shingle technologies can lower summer attic temperatures by up to 15%, reducing cooling loads according to DOE data.
- ROI Data: According to Remodeling Magazine's Cost vs. Value report for the Pacific region, roof replacement recoups approximately 60% to 65% of its cost upon home sale.
- Permitting Time: The City of Folsom Community Development Department processes standard residential roofing permits within 2 to 4 business days.
- Material Lifespan: Standard architectural shingles last 20 to 25 years in Folsom's climate, while metal roofing systems can endure 50+ years.

Folsom Roofing Material Recommendations
Top roofing materials chosen for durability against regional storms.
- Architectural Asphalt Shingles: Thick, dual-layered shingles providing superior wind and rain resistance, highly popular in local neighborhoods.
- Class 4 Impact-Resistant Shingles: Specially reinforced shingles designed to withstand severe weather strikes without cracking, potentially lowering insurance premiums.
- Standing Seam Metal Roofing: Highly durable metal panels with concealed fasteners that effortlessly shed heavy rain and resist high wind uplift.
